Warning Signs of A Bad Electrical Outlet

There are several indicators that can indicate your electrical outlets in Bend, Oregon are going bad. Below are a few warning signs to look for in your home or commercial building.

  1. Sparking Outlet

An outlet that sparks when plugging in any appliance or other electrical device is an obvious sign something isn’t right with your electrical system. This could be one of the many warning signs of an electrical fire about to ignite.

  1. Melted Outlet or Discolored Outlet Cover Plate

If you notice one or more outlets are melted in your home or business, this is another indication that the outlet(s) in question is highly dangerous and poses a fire hazard, even when not in use.

  1. Smoking Outlet

A smoking outlet indicates your outlet is not working properly and has sustained damage, possibly due to heavy use, cracking, corrosion, etc. Whatever the reason, if one or more of the electrical outlets in your home or business are smoking, contact a certified commercial or residential electrician in Bend, Oregon as soon as possible.

  1. Burning Odors

If you notice a burning smell coming from an electrical outlet, or a burning odor is present in the building without any identifiable source, these are warning signs that your outlet(s) may be faulty.

  1. Outlet Feels Hot

If an outlet feels hot to the touch, even if it’s only one side of the outlet, this is another indicator that your outlet(s) are going bad and pose a danger to your home or business.

  1. Loose Plug

If a plug falls out of a power outlet when you go to use it, or a plug sits loosely in the outlet, these are indicators that the outlet is old and has endured excess wear. This poses a fire hazard just like an electrical outlet sparking would. This is because loose outlets indicate wire connections are aged, weak, and unreliable.

  1. Tripped Circuit Breaker

If you’re constantly tripping the circuit breaker every time you plug something into an outlet, this is a common sign that the outlet isn’t working properly and needs to be inspected by an electrician.
